Sue Manno Obituary

 

Sue S. Manno, 72, of 118 Taft Road, St. Marys, died peacefully on Monday, February 26, 2018 at UPMC Presbyterian Hospital following a short illness.

She was born on May 14, 1945, in St. Marys, a daughter of the late Luke and Sara Jane Miles Schaberl.

On August 25, 1978 in St. Marys, she married Leroy Manno, who survives.

Sue was a lifelong resident of the area and a graduate of ECCHS, class of 1963.  She was a member of St. Marys Church and retired from Babcock Lumber after many years of service.  Until the time of her death, she was employed as a coach at Curves in St. Marys, and very much enjoyed her time there.  She also enjoyed shopping and bus trips with her friends.  She will be remembered for her generous and loving nature and as a strong and kind wife, mother, and grandmother.

In addition to her husband, Leroy Manno, she is survived by one daughter,
Kim (Scott) Johnson of Hampton, VA, one granddaughter, Andreana Hopkins, and by a step-grandson, Luke Johnson.  She is also survived by two sisters, Kathleen (Robert) Brennen and Elizabeth (Jeffrey) Slaughenhaupt, both of St. Marys, by two brothers, John (Shirley) Schaberl of Charlotte, NC, and Michael Schaberl of Johnsonburg, as well as by numerous nieces and nephews.

In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by two brothers, Andrew Schaberl and Luke "George" Schaberl, and by one sister, Sylvia Feldbauer.

A Mass of Christian Burial for Sue S. Manno will be celebrated on Saturday, March 3, 2018, at 10:00 AM at St. Marys Church, Church Street, St. Marys, PA with Fr. Peter Augustine Pierjok, Pastor, officiating.

The family will receive friends at church from 9:30 AM until the time of the Mass.

Interment will be in St. Marys Catholic Cemetery.

Memorial Contributions may be made to St. Jude Children's Research Hospital or to the American Cancer Society.
